Our review of these blackout curtains finds them best for bedrooms, nurseries, and anyone who needs a reliably dark, quieter room. The single biggest reason to buy is the double-layer construction with a black liner that delivers true 100% light blocking and noticeable thermal benefit, creating a darker, cooler space for sleep or naps. The pairing of heavy polyester fabric and a second black backing produces better light and noise reduction than a typical single-layer drape.
Key Features
- Set configuration: Comes as a set of 2 panels, providing full window coverage without extra purchases.
- Panel size and fit: Each panel measures 42 in by 63 in and has 6 silver metal grommets, making them easy to hang and slide on most standard rods.
- Complete blackout: Double-layer construction with a black liner is thick enough to block sunlight and UV for a fully dark room.
- Noise and privacy: The extra lining reduces outside noise and increases privacy compared with a single-layer curtain.
- Energy saving: The insulated backing helps reduce heat gain and loss through windows, which can improve room comfort and lower energy use.
- Low maintenance: Polyester fabric is machine washable on gentle cycle and simple to care for.
Who It's For
This set is ideal for people who need a reliable blackout solution for bedrooms, nurseries, shift-worker sleep schedules, or media rooms where stray light is an issue. The insulated liner also appeals to those wanting to keep rooms cooler in summer or reduce drafts in winter.
Those who need floor-length custom sizing, decorative sheer layers, or an ultra-heavy soundproof curtain should look elsewhere; these panels are mid-weight polyester with focus on blackout and insulation rather than designer drapery details or specialist acoustic performance.

Specifications
| Brand | ChrisDowa |
| Material | Polyester with black liner |
| Set contents | 2 total blackout curtain panels |
| Panel size | 42 in wide x 63 in long |
| Grommets | 6 silver metal grommets per panel, 1.6 in inner diameter |
| Care | Machine wash gentle below 86F; tumble dry low; warm iron; do not bleach |
